Microsoft Teams
Teams is a collaboration platform that offers document storage, chat channels and online video and phone calls. The app is available with a Microsoft365 or Office365 subscription.
Because of its integration with Office365, Teams makes for a seamless collaboration tool to use across Microsoft Word, Powerpoint and Excel documents – rather than setting up several different apps alongside it.
Another great feature is the user’s ability to follow channels that they’re interested in/participate in as well as hide any channels they don’t wish to see while working – making the app one of the more customisable options for an efficient workflow.
With Teams, you can stay connected on your mobile device at any time using the mobile smartphone app. With the app, you have access to all your chat messages and documents, and you can also respond to other channels and join meetings in the same way that you would via desktop, PC or web browser.
Airtable
Airtable is a platform that allows you and your team to create and share databases. The app itself is very user-friendly – you don’t need to be a database expert to use it.
As well as creating and sharing databases, the app allows you to store, organise and communicate on tasks presented on the database.
The app is a lot like a spreadsheet, except simpler and more user-friendly. Airtable allows you to organise a large amount of information as well as the relationships between that information, which means that you can categorise everything much easier too.
Airtable has a valuable import feature that allows you to import data from other devices, meaning that you can work seamlessly across the app. The flexibility is what sets it apart from other database apps – adapting to whatever your needs are.
Slack
Slack is a business communication app that allows teams in different locations e.g. in the work office or working remotely from home. It allows these teams to communicate, share documents, and organise workspaces all in one place.
Many businesses use Slack as a replacement for work emails – due to the real-time responses and easy user interface.
The biggest benefit to using Slack is that the app is streamlined. It offers easy methods of communication such as open channels, private channels and direct messages.
Another benefit is Slack’s easy integration into other apps like Google Drive and MailChimp. When you keep everything in sync on Slack, it becomes the central hub for workplace productivity, communication and document sharing.
You can also share files in various formats such as PDF’s, Word docs and Google Docs.
Slack has released updates for its mobile and desktop apps, complementing each other perfectly for a seamless workflow experience.
The mobile version is simple and easy to use and can be downloaded on iPhone and Android phones. Like the desktop app, it also offers a “mentions and reactions” screen, where the users can find messages that mention them quickly and efficiently.
